Flu Vaccine Crucial Amid HIV

HIV positive patients shouldn’t pass on their flu shots, according to recent studies that emphasize the importance of influenza and measles vaccinations for HIV positive patients. In one study of 51,021 HIV positive people, researchers found that people taking antiretroviral drugs were more likely to receive the influenza vaccine, while people with higher viral loads and lower CD4 cell counts were less likely to be immunized.
